Heavy towing does not automatically damage a diesel truck. It does justify a use-specific inspection that compares hitch and chassis evidence with service records, loaded use and the seller's description.
Start with the trailer and towing story
Ask what was towed, how often, over what terrain and whether the truck carried a fifth-wheel, gooseneck or conventional hitch. Request trailer weights, scale tickets or service records when available.
Bed, hitch and rear structure
Inspect hitch mounting, bed deformation, holes, wiring, frame attachments, rear axle area, springs, shocks and bump stops. Normal evidence of a correctly installed hitch is different from cracked, loose or improvised work.
- Check hitch labels and mounting hardware.
- Look for mismatched repairs, elongation, corrosion or interference.
- Confirm whether removed hitch equipment left concealed damage.
Powertrain and thermal history
Review transmission service, cooling-system work, axle service and any documented temperature or warning events. A road test should evaluate engine and transmission behaviour without pretending one drive certifies remaining life.
Brakes, tires and loaded-use evidence
Inspect brake condition, tire load ratings, matched tire wear, wheel condition and trailer-brake wiring. Uneven wear or overheated components require further investigation, not a single-cause diagnosis.
- Compare tire condition across all positions, including duals.
- Check steering and suspension wear under qualified inspection.
- Verify that the exact payload label fits the proposed future trailer.
